Eternal Echoes in Carrara Stone

Carrara stone, renowned for its luminous beauty and enduring strength, has resonated through the eras. Its pristine white surface, marbled with delicate veining, serves as a stage upon which history paints its visions. Each block of Carrara, hewn from the Italian quarries, carries within it the memories of countless artisans who have molded its form into statues. From Michelangelo's David to the ethereal sculptures of contemporary artists, Carrara stone has exceeded time, leaving behind an enduring legacy that continues to amaze generations.

From Block to Beauty: The Making of a Marble Masterpiece

A journey from humble quarry slab to captivating sculpture begins with the careful procurement of the finest marble. Each chunk is scrutinized for its inherent beauty, ensuring that the final masterpiece will exhibit the material's unique character.

The artisan then interprets their imagination into a series of precise strokes, guided by years of training. Utilizing specialized tools, they slowly liberate the sculpture's hidden form, layer by increment.

The process is a delicate dance between precision and finesse, as each action can either enhance or diminish the overall piece.
